## Audio Playback Tuning — Galleria Vox v2.4

The Galleria Vox app prefetches audio segments as visitors approach each exhibit beacon at the Harrowfield Museum pilot. Prefetch distance, buffer depth, and beacon debounce were retuned after the October walkthrough showed stutter in the sculpture wing, where beacon density is highest. These values ship frozen for this release; any change requires a regression pass on the low-end devices in the loaner pool. The constants below are the values baked into the 2.4 build.

tuning constants:
QUOTAS = {
    "druwyn": 5,
    "holix": 5,
    "zorath": 5,
    "holwyn": 10,
}

For review purposes: it holds a read-only token scoped to the deploy orchestrator's status API and cannot trigger, cancel, or roll back deployments. It posts environment names, commit short-hashes, and pass/fail states — no secrets, diffs, or config values. Messages are retained per standard chat policy. The bot runs in the shared tooling cluster under its own service account, rotated quarterly. The full permission matrix and token-rotation procedure are documented on the internal page below.

wiki page, tahaf-tajog: https://jira.ordindyn.corp/pipeline

Welcome aboard — quick handover on the Larkspool build farm. We had repeated artifact rejections last month caused by clock skew between agents; NTP sync is now enforced at boot, so timestamps should match. If a signed build still fails validation, re-sign it manually using the key provided below.

deploy key for kafof-kaguf: bky9_WnPyu8S2E

This release changes several validator defaults for the Oakline podcast feed validator. Strict enclosure checking is now on by default, the episode GUID uniqueness check rejects rather than warns, and the feed fetch timeout was lowered to reduce worker pileup during the nightly crawl. On-call: expect a brief spike in rejection alerts over the first 48 hours as publishers adjust; these are expected and should not be paged out. The full set of active configuration values after this release is as follows:

service settings:
[eliax]
port = 6379
region = lower-4
host = eliax.paliqlabs.corp
timeout_ms = 750
retries = 3